For some employees salary was revised and after revision, their salary slab went above 10000 and their esic should not be deducted, but the system is deducting esic.
And when I run payroll for the month sept. esic is deducting and for the month oct it is not deducting.
The reason was as per esic slab is Apr-Sept and Oct-Mar
if an employee falls under esic even his/her salary increases above 10000 the system continues to deduct upto the slab and automatically stops after the slab.
Is there any settings by that whenever emp. salary changes and he cross the limit esic should not be deducted.

Hi.. please do not change the constant. it would affect the other employees. Also, it is better that you advice the employees on the statuatory rules. All these information are subject to audit controls and it would not present a good report if audited.
ESI deduction is based on the ESI cycle. Please check with your concerned authorities on the ESI cycles for the areas.

If u really want to stop deducting ESI you can delimit the ESI Date in IT 588
But its against the statutory norms

When the employees salary crosses the esic limit, the employees are asking the hr dept. why my esic is being deducted.
So the end user asked me to solve this query.
And I identified that as per statutory norms. It will automatically deduct for 6 months.
Say If an employee's salary increases in the month of may that means for the remaining period his esic will be deducted.
And the employees are not accepting this.
That is why i want to change it.
